What are the best practices for ensuring scalability in Networking Services?

Implementing best practices for scalability in Networking Services involves several key strategies. First, utilize a modular architecture. This allows for easy addition of resources as demand grows. Second, leverage cloud services for on-demand resource allocation. Cloud providers like AWS and Azure enable scalable infrastructure. Third, optimize network performance through load balancing. This distributes traffic efficiently across servers. Fourth, employ automation for resource management. Automation tools can dynamically allocate resources based on real-time demand. Fifth, monitor performance metrics continuously. This helps identify bottlenecks and allows for proactive adjustments. Lastly, ensure redundancy in network design. Redundant systems prevent single points of failure, enhancing reliability. These practices collectively support scalable and efficient networking services.

What security measures are critical for effective Networking Services?

Critical security measures for effective Networking Services include firewalls, encryption, and intrusion detection systems. Firewalls act as barriers that monitor and control incoming and outgoing network traffic. They prevent unauthorized access to or from a private network. Encryption protects sensitive data by converting it into a secure format that can only be read by authorized users. Intrusion detection systems monitor network traffic for suspicious activity and potential threats. Regular software updates and patch management are essential to protect against vulnerabilities. Additionally, implementing strong access controls limits who can access network resources. Training staff on security best practices is also vital for maintaining a secure networking environment. These measures collectively enhance the security posture of networking services, safeguarding against data breaches and cyber threats.

How can businesses assess the security of their Networking Services?

Businesses can assess the security of their Networking Services by conducting regular security audits. These audits evaluate the effectiveness of existing security measures. They identify vulnerabilities within the network infrastructure. Businesses should also implement [censured] testing to simulate cyber-attacks. This testing reveals weaknesses that could be exploited by malicious actors. Additionally, monitoring network traffic can help detect unusual activities. Using security information and event management (SIEM) systems provides real-time analysis of security alerts. Compliance with industry standards, such as ISO 27001, further ensures robust security practices. Regular employee training on security protocols is essential for maintaining a secure environment.

What metrics can be used to measure the efficiency gains from Networking Services?

Key metrics to measure efficiency gains from Networking Services include bandwidth utilization, latency, and packet loss. Bandwidth utilization measures the amount of data being transmitted versus the total available bandwidth. Latency indicates the time taken for data to travel from source to destination, affecting responsiveness. Packet loss represents the percentage of packets that fail to reach their destination, impacting data integrity.

Additionally, network throughput measures the actual rate of successful data transfer. Mean time to repair (MTTR) assesses the average time taken to resolve network issues. User satisfaction scores can also gauge the perceived effectiveness of networking services. These metrics provide a comprehensive view of networking efficiency and performance.
